Key Facts You Must to Grasp About Home Care Services
Home care services play an essential role in supporting people who require help due to getting older, illness, or disability. These services encompass a range of personalized care choices, including medical and non-medical assistance tailored to individual needs. Care can include help with daily activities such as bathing, dressing, and meal preparation, as well as skilled nursing services like medication management and physical therapy.
Families often seek home care to allow their loved ones to remain in comfortable environments while receiving necessary support. It can provide significant relief for family caregivers, who may struggle to balance work and personal responsibilities. Understanding the different kinds of home care services offered is vital for choosing wisely. Assessing the specific needs of the individual and exploring local service providers can assist families choose the right care plan, guaranteeing that their loved ones receive compassionate and effective support at home.

Home Care Solutions Types
Home care solutions encompass a range of types developed to meet various individual needs. These services can broadly be classified into non-medical and medical care. Non-medical home care usually includes assistance with daily living activities, such as personal hygiene, meal preparation, and companionship. Caregivers may also help with light housekeeping and errands, establishing a comfortable and supportive environment.
By contrast, medical home care constitutes skilled services rendered by licensed professionals. This may include nursing care, movement therapy, and medication management, adjusted to people managing specific health conditions. Additionally, specialized services encompassing palliative care benefit those with recurring health problems, placing emphasis on comfort and quality of life.
Deciding on the Proper Home Care Professional
How can someone assure they choose the most appropriate home care provider? The process starts with establishing particular requirements, as needs can differ substantially among persons. Conducting detailed research is vital; prospective clients should investigate different providers and their services. Internet testimonials and testimonials can deliver perspectives into the caliber of care rendered.
In addition, interviews with prospective providers are significant. These discussions enable families to determine compatibility, assess communication styles, and specify service approaches. It is also necessary to inquire about the qualifications and training of care professionals, confirming they maintain the necessary skills and certifications.
Moreover, grasping the financial aspects, including payment choices and insurance protection, is significant to prevent unexpected costs. Finally, confidence and comfort are essential; families should feel confident that their loved ones will obtain caring, dependable care in their own homes.

Frequently Asked Questions
How Can I Settle for Home Care Services?
People can pay for home care services through direct funds, long-term care insurance, Medicaid, or Medicare, depending on eligibility. Investigating various funding options makes certain that families identify proper monetary arrangements for needed care support.
Do Home Care Services Cater to Pets?
Services for home care can frequently accommodate pets, based on the company's procedures. It's important for relatives to talk through unique requirements and accommodations with the company to ensure a suitable setting for both the resident and their pets.
What Skills Do Caregivers Generally Acquire?
Caregivers usually earn professional credentials in nursing or supportive assistance, preparation in CPR and first aid, and often have background in care for the elderly. Many also undergo background checks and receive advanced training to provide for distinct patient needs.
How Can I Reduce Care Staff Staff Attrition?
To address caregiver turnover, one should concentrate on enhancing communication, providing competitive wages, providing continuous training, and fostering a supportive work environment. These strategies can improve staff stability and encourage caregivers to remain dedicated long-term.
Can Younger Individuals Obtain Home Care Support?
Yes, home care is obtainable for younger individuals. Many agencies furnish specialized services to meet the particular needs of this sector, providing support for various conditions, encompassing disabilities, chronic illnesses, or recovery from surgery.
